دَوْرَة

course /ˈdaw.ra/

nounB1#1732 most common

Also: cycle, session, round (of a tournament)

Example sentences

أُريدُ دَوْرَةً في اللُّغَةِ العَرَبِيَّة.
I want a course in Arabic.
بَدَأَتِ الدَّوْرَةُ التَّدْريبيَّةُ أَمْس.
The training course started yesterday.
سَجَّلْتُ في دَوْرَةٍ لِتَعَلُّمِ البَرْمَجَة.
I signed up for a course to learn programming.
تُقامُ الدَّوْرَةُ الأُولِمبيَّةُ كُلَّ أَرْبَعِ سَنَوات.
The Olympic Games are held every four years.
خَرَجَ الفَريقُ مِنَ الدَّوْرَةِ بَعْدَ خَسارَتِهِ في الدَّوْرِ النِّهائي.
The team exited the tournament after losing in the final round.
أَقَرَّ البَرْلَمانُ القانونَ في آخِرِ جَلْسَةٍ مِنْ دَوْرَتِهِ التَّشْريعيَّةِ الحاليَّة.
Parliament passed the law in the last session of its current legislative term.

Declension

CaseSingularPlural
Nominativeدَوْرَةٌدَوْراتٌ
Genitiveدَوْرَةٍدَوْراتٍ
Accusativeدَوْرَةًدَوْراتٍ
Vocativeيا دَوْرَةُيا دَوْراتُ

Etymology

The word comes from the Semitic triliteral root د-و-ر (d-w-r), which means to turn or revolve. A دَوْرَة is one turn of the wheel: a cycle, a round, or a course of study that comes around in sequence. The same root gives دار (to revolve), دائرة (circle), and مُدير (director).
